Thread (16 messages) 16 messages, 2 authors, 2025-08-17
STALE318d
Revisions (3)
  1. v1 current
  2. v2 [diff vs current]
  3. v3 [diff vs current]

[PATCH 6/9] dt-bindings: nvme: apple,nvme-ans: Add Apple A11

From: Nick Chan <hidden>
Date: 2025-08-11 13:51:55
Also in: asahi, linux-arm-kernel, linux-iommu, linux-nvme, lkml
Subsystem: arm/apple machine support, open firmware and flattened device tree bindings, the rest · Maintainers: Sven Peter, Janne Grunau, Rob Herring, Krzysztof Kozlowski, Conor Dooley, Linus Torvalds

Add ANS2 NVMe bindings for Apple A11 SoC.

Signed-off-by: Nick Chan <redacted>
---
 .../devicetree/bindings/nvme/apple,nvme-ans.yaml          | 15 +++++++++------
 1 file changed, 9 insertions(+), 6 deletions(-)
diff --git a/Documentation/devicetree/bindings/nvme/apple,nvme-ans.yaml b/Documentation/devicetree/bindings/nvme/apple,nvme-ans.yaml
index fc6555724e1858e8a16f6750302ff0ad9c4e5b88..4127d7b0a0f066fd0e144b32d1b676e3406b9d5a 100644
--- a/Documentation/devicetree/bindings/nvme/apple,nvme-ans.yaml
+++ b/Documentation/devicetree/bindings/nvme/apple,nvme-ans.yaml
@@ -11,12 +11,14 @@ maintainers:
 
 properties:
   compatible:
-    items:
-      - enum:
-          - apple,t8103-nvme-ans2
-          - apple,t8112-nvme-ans2
-          - apple,t6000-nvme-ans2
-      - const: apple,nvme-ans2
+    oneOf:
+      - const: apple,t8015-nvme-ans2
+      - items:
+          - enum:
+              - apple,t8103-nvme-ans2
+              - apple,t8112-nvme-ans2
+              - apple,t6000-nvme-ans2
+          - const: apple,nvme-ans2
 
   reg:
     items:
@@ -67,6 +69,7 @@ if:
     compatible:
       contains:
         enum:
+          - apple,t8015-nvme-ans2
           - apple,t8103-nvme-ans2
           - apple,t8112-nvme-ans2
 then:
-- 
2.50.1
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help